About The Position

This position is responsible for supporting on-site construction activity, assisting construction managers and subcontractors/trade partners in building and completing homes safely, on time and within budget. Responsibilities

  • Assists in maintaining a clean and organized jobsite
  • Oversees completion of walk-through items/punch lists
  • Schedules and inspects work completed by trade partners
  • Updates schedules to reflect accurate progression/stage of the build process
  • Manages material orders and deliveries to meet needs of project schedule
  • Prioritizes labor and equipment resources as needed to avoid delays
  • Assists in resolving customer concerns
  • Conducts daily physical inspection of each house to determine progress and to ensure staff and trade partners comply with Company safety and quality control standards
  • Ensures staff and subcontractors follow Company and Division construction, quality control, and safety methods
  • Ensures scheduling and payment systems are up to date to ensure Trade Partner get paid promptly
  • Studies and understands project specifications, plans, and scopes of work to manage each project effectively
